The Conotton Valley Rockets are taking a road trip to take on the Strasburg-Franklin Tigers at 5:45 p.m. on Monday. Conotton Valley is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 8.2 runs per game this season.

Conotton Valley will roll into the contest after a wild two-game stretch: they only put up two runs on Thursday, then bounced right back against Beallsville on Friday. The Rockets' pitcher stepped up to hand the Blue Devils a 19-0 shutout. The Rockets haven't had any issues with the Blue Devils recently, as the game was their third consecutive victory against them.

Dylan Higgenbotham was a major factor no matter where he played. On the mound, he kept things locked down with no earned runs or hits over five innings pitched. What's more, he posted five strikeouts, the most he's had since back in April. He was also big at the plate, going 1-for-3 with two runs, two RBI, and one double. He has become a key player for Conotton Valley: the team is undefeated when he posts at least two runs, but 7-8 otherwise.

In other batting news, Kam Wright was incredible, going a perfect 3-for-3 with three runs, one triple, and two RBI. That's the most runs he has posted since back in April. Logan Henry also deserves some recognition as he snagged his first stolen base of the season.

Conotton Valley always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.600.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Beallsville only posted an OBP of .062.

Garaway hit Strasburg-Franklin with a four-run sixth inning on Friday, which goes a long way in explaining the final result. The Tigers took a 7-4 hit to the loss column at the hands of the Pirates. The loss continues a trend for the Tigers in their meetings with the Pirates: they've now lost four in a row.

Strasburg-Franklin saw three different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Avery Keffer, who went 1-for-3 with one RBI. Brody Baughmam was another, getting on base in three of his four plate appearances with two runs.

Conotton Valley's record now sits at 12-8. As for Strasburg-Franklin, they now have a losing record of 10-11.

Strasburg-Franklin's pitching crew has a crucial task ahead of them: Conotton Valley hasn't had any issues making contact this season, having earned a batting average of .326. It's a different story for Strasburg-Franklin, though, as they've only averaged .256. Will they be able to contain Conotton Valley's hitters?

Conotton Valley might still be hurting after the 12-6 defeat they got from Strasburg-Franklin when the teams last played back in April of 2024. Can the Rockets avenge their loss or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
